DESCRIPTION:The 29th annual meeting on The Biology of Genomes will begin at 7:30 pm on Tuesday\, May 10\, 2016 and run through lunch on Saturday\, May 14. \nThe 2016 meeting will address DNA sequence variation and its role in molecular evolution\, population genetics and complex diseases\, comparative genomics\, large-scale studies of gene and protein expression\, and genomic approaches to ecological systems. Both technologies and applications will be emphasized. In addition there will be a special session on the ethical\, legal and social implications (ELSI) of genome research. \n\nTopics:\n\n\nTranslational Genomics & Genetics\nGenetics of Complex Traits\nCancer & Medical Genomics\nFunctional Genomics\nComputational Genomics\nEvolutionary & Non-Human Genomics\nPopulation Genomics\n\n\nKeynote Speakers:\nEmmanuelle Charpentier\, Max Planck Institute for Infection Biology\, Germany\nNeil Shubin\, University of Chicago
